PROJECT CONCEPT
Horizontal planes extend outward to create shaded spaces, while vertical timber screens soften the overall massing and provide privacy. The entire design relies on a highly considered L-shaped configuration that maximizes outdoor living, natural light, and the connection to the central open space.
- Site & Base Volume: Establishes a clean L-shaped footprint that intelligently responds to the site orientation while maximizing privacy and perfectly framing the primary pool and outdoor living zone.
- Volume Articulation: The L-shaped mass extends vertically to form aligned lower and middle floors, strengthening the courtyard edge and increasing usable area while preserving the central open space.
- Stacking & Zoning: The recessed top floor creates private roof terraces, privacy buffers, and shaded outdoor spaces, emphasizing vertical zoning for private suites above.
